360° PRODUCT VIEWER

By using this file it is possible to create a 360° product viewer with no Actionscript knowledge required! By inserting a number of images with views from different angles of the product the file automatically adjusts to create the interactive viewer.

Features

  • Very easy implementation!
  • Rotation by mouse control, keyboard arrow keys and mousewheel!
  • Label angles (e.g. side views);
  • Small file size (excluding the images);
  • Grabhand cursor (optional);
  • Setting a zoom range;
  • Adding hotspots for product details;
  • Playback functionality.

Enable/disable the following properties:

  • Inertia of the object (give it a swing!);
  • Blur of the object while spinning;
  • The object's reflection;
  • Blur of the object's reflection;
  • The object spinning in when starting up the movie;
  • Draggable object (disable when only using playback);
  • Grabhand cursor.

Change properties:

  • The amount of images (more images provide a smooth rotation);
  • Speed of spinning;
  • Amount of inertia;
  • Mousewheel functionality (can be set to object rotation, zoom and no functionality).

Zooming:

A zoom range can be set between which the object can zoom by using a setZoom method. Detailed information is provided about how to enable zooming.

Playback functionality:

Use three different methods: one step forward, one step back and setPlayback to a certain position. Detailed information is provided about how to use playback.

Adding hotspots:

Adding hotspots (like the one in the preview) in order to see a product detail is very easy to do. Detailed information is provided about how to set hotspots.
